Driving instructor here, it's about the same as it's always been for me. Most of my pupils are college students 17-19. Have a few older pupils 20's and 30's sprinkled in asy area has a lot of people in that age bracket that have moved from London or didn't start to learn until after Uni.

It's expensive so teenagers don't usually learn unless their parents pay for it.

The test waiting times and expense of it all does have an impact on a lot of teens. It will also depend on area. Good transport links will usually make it so more people don't need to drive. If it's a rural area mostly all learn because of necessity.
